WebCarboxylic acids react with Thionyl Chloride ( S O C l 2) to form acid chlorides. During the reaction the hydroxyl group of the carboxylic acid is converted to a chlorosulfite intermediate making it a better leaving group. WebFormation of an acyl halide from a carboxylic acid; Carboxylic acids react with thionyl chloride (SOCl 2) or phosphorus pentachloride (PCl 5) to form an acid chloride (R-CO-Cl). Example: The chemical reaction of ethanoic acid with SOCl 2 produces ethanoyl chloride while hydrogen chloride gas and sulfur dioxide are released as by-products. WebSep 24, 2024 · Reaction of primary amides with thionyl chloride (SOCl 2) creates nitriles. Hydride reduction using LiAlH 4 causes the carbonyl oxygen of the amide to eliminate as a leaving group creating the corresponding amine. Lactams, cyclic amides, are affected by these reactions in the same fashion as acyclic amides.

WebIn carboxylic acid: Conversion to acid derivatives …of a carboxylic acid with thionyl chloride, SOCl 2 (often in the presence of an amine such as pyridine, C 5 H 5 N), converts the carboxyl group to the corresponding acyl chloride (RCOOH → RCOCl).
